Common issues include electrical system faults (like battery drain or sensor failures), suspension component wear from East End potholes and rough roads, and problems with the COMAND infotainment system. The coastal humidity can also accelerate corrosion on electrical connectors and undercarriage components.
Look for shops with Mercedes-specific diagnostic tools like STAR/XENTRY systems and technicians with Mercedes-Benz training certifications (e.g., ASE Master with Mercedes experience). In Riverhead, reputable shops often have long-standing local reputations, so check reviews and ask for referrals from other Mercedes owners at local dealerships or car meets.

Seek immediate service for any dashboard warning lights (especially red ones like coolant or oil pressure), unusual noises from the suspension or brakes after hitting a pothole, or if you experience any drivability issues on high-traffic routes like Route 58 or County Road 105, where a breakdown could be hazardous.
Yes, consider seasonal traffic; schedule major service outside the busy summer tourist season for quicker turnaround. Also, given the proximity to saltwater, more frequent undercarriage washes and inspections for corrosion are recommended, especially if you live near the coast or drive on treated winter roads.
